Cornwall Air Ambulance launches Superhero 5k challenge
UK-based Cornwall Air Ambulance is encouraging supporters to dress as superheroes for their latest fundraising challenge
The lifesaving charity has launched the ‘5K in a Day - Superhero Challenge’ asking supporters to walk, run, jog, cycle any route of their choice over the weekend of 5 to 6 June, to raise vital funds to keep the helicopter flying and saving lives across Cornwall and the Isles of Scilly. It’s free to sign up and participants who raise a minimum of £20 in sponsorship will receive a superhero medal as a thank you from Cornwall Air Ambulance.
Sherelle Puertas, Fundraising Officer for Cornwall Air Ambulance, said: “Lots of people regard the aircrew as heroes working on the frontline, but our supporters are heroes too – they keep the helicopter flying each year. That is why we wanted to launch this brand-new challenge.
“It’s a fun, family-friendly event and you can even get the dog involved! Whether you complete your 5k as your favourite superhero or just as the hero you are without a costume, we just want people to have fun and hopefully raise some money in the process. Any donation, big or small, will help towards saving lives here in Cornwall.”
Fundraising for the charity important as it’s busier than ever
With visitors planning on flocking to the county in their millions this summer, the critical care team could be busier than ever and fundraising for the charity has never been so important.
